2025 Advocacy Day
We had a great turn out for our annual advocacy day, with a number of PGY4 Dartmouth and Portsmouth psychiatry residents joining, as well as fellows from the Dartmouth Child and Adolescent Psychiatry Fellowship and Leadership and Preventative Medicine Residency Program. Several Dartmouth Hitchcock attending psychiatrists also joined. New Futures led a fun and educational day that included a legislative breakfast, several sessions about the legislative process and ways to effectively advocate, and a tour of the New Hampshire State House. Attendees also had the opportunity to interact with several legislators, including Senator Sue Prentiss, Senator Tim McGough, and Representative David Nagel. We look forward already to next year’s Advocacy Day.
Ronald Shellow Award
This May, Dr. Robert Feder stepped down from his post as NH Representative to the APA Assembly, which he has held for the past 29 years! He was recognized on the last day of the May 2025 APA Assembly meeting with the Ronald A. Shellow Award. Thank you, Bob for representing New Hampshire at the Assembly and for your significant contributions over the years

2025 NHPS Annual Meeting
We were treated to a number of wonderful talks at the NHPS annual meeting on April 11th 2025, including talks on geriatric psychiatry and dementia, effective treatments for obesity, and recent advances in the treatment of Schizophrenia, including the role of the muscarinic cholinergic system. Judge Barbara Maloney and Judge David D. King were awarded the NHPS Leadership Award for their decades of service addressing the mental health needs of New Hampshire citizens. We thanked Bob Feder for his decades of service as our assembly representative, and Kathleen Duemling for her tireless work organizing our CME and other events over many years. Brian Rosen and Madeline Schneider, respectively, will take their helms going forward. We look forward to having many of you join us again for this educational opportunity next year.
